117.info
人生若只如初见

Debian如何监控copendir活动

在Debian系统中,监控copendir活动可以通过多种方式实现,包括使用系统日志、审计工具或编写自定义脚本来跟踪目录操作。以下是一些方法:

1. 使用系统日志

Debian系统默认会将一些系统调用和错误信息记录到系统日志中。你可以查看/var/log/syslog/var/log/messages文件来查找与copendir相关的信息。

grep "copendir" /var/log/syslog

或者

grep "copendir" /var/log/messages

2. 使用审计工具(auditd)

auditd是一个强大的审计工具,可以用来监控和记录系统调用和文件操作。你可以配置auditd来监控特定的目录和操作。

安装auditd

sudo apt-get update
sudo apt-get install auditd audispd-plugins

配置auditd

编辑/etc/audit/audit.rules文件,添加以下规则来监控特定目录的copendir操作:

-a exit,always -F arch=b64 -S coprocess -k coprocess
-a exit,always -F arch=b32 -S coprocess -k coprocess

然后重启auditd服务:

sudo systemctl restart auditd

查看审计日志

你可以使用ausearchaureport工具来查看和分析审计日志。

sudo ausearch -k coprocess

或者

sudo aureport -k coprocess

3. 编写自定义脚本

你可以编写一个自定义脚本来监控copendir活动。以下是一个简单的示例脚本:

#!/bin/bash

MONITOR_DIR="/path/to/monitor"

inotifywait -m -r -e create,delete,modify --format '%w%f' "${MONITOR_DIR}" | while read FILE
do
    echo "Directory changed: ${FILE}"
    lsof +D "${FILE}"
done

将上述脚本保存为monitor_copendir.sh,然后运行:

chmod +x monitor_copendir.sh
./monitor_copendir.sh

这个脚本使用inotifywait来监控指定目录的变化,并在检测到变化时输出相关信息。

总结

以上方法可以帮助你在Debian系统中监控copendir活动。你可以根据自己的需求选择合适的方法。系统日志和审计工具提供了较为全面的监控能力,而自定义脚本则提供了更大的灵活性。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fefd9AzsNAw9fBVI.html

推荐文章

  • debian进程如何更新配置

    在Debian系统中,更新进程的配置通常涉及以下几个步骤:
    1. 停止相关服务
    首先,你需要停止正在运行的服务或进程。可以使用systemctl命令来管理服务。...

  • Python在Debian上的安装步骤是什么

    在Debian系统上安装Python的步骤如下:
    更新软件包列表
    首先,打开终端并更新软件包列表,以确保安装最新版本的软件包。
    sudo apt update 安装Py...

  • 怎样提升Debian服务器性能

    要提升Debian服务器的性能,可以从多个方面入手,包括硬件优化、系统配置优化、软件优化等。以下是一些具体的建议:
    硬件优化 增加内存: 如果服务器经常出...

  • 在Debian上如何切换Compton和Xorg

    在Debian上切换Compton和Xorg可以通过以下步骤实现:
    安装Compton 更新系统包列表:
    sudo apt update 安装Compton:
    sudo apt install compton 配...

  • Debian系统Filebeat安全设置指南

    在Debian系统中设置Filebeat时,确保系统的安全性是至关重要的。以下是一些关键的安全设置步骤和建议:
    更新系统
    确保系统始终是最新的,以修补已知的...

  • Ubuntu deluser命令的语法格式

    deluser 命令用于从系统中删除用户帐户。其基本语法格式如下:
    deluser [选项] 用户名 其中,用户名 是要删除的用户的用户名。下面是一些常用的选项: --re...

  • VirtualBox里CentOS虚拟机如何扩容

    在VirtualBox中扩容CentOS虚拟机的磁盘空间,可以按照以下步骤进行操作:
    1. 关闭虚拟机
    首先,确保你的CentOS虚拟机已经关闭。
    2. 调整虚拟磁盘...

  • Linux文件压缩与解压技巧有哪些

    在Linux系统中,文件压缩和解压是非常常见的操作,掌握这些技巧可以提高工作效率和文件管理的效率。以下是一些常用的压缩与解压技巧:
    常用压缩命令 tar命令...